Which car has the tightest turning circle?
The Smart Fortwo is arguably the car with the lowest turning circle in the American car market. It has an impressive turning radius of 22.8 feet, which is smaller than any other vehicle we know. This makes sense, given that the Fortwo’s mission is to make city travel easier for buyers.

What do you mean by turning radius?
Turning radius of a car Turning circle radius gives an indication of the space required to turn a particular vehicle. Technically speaking, it is the radius (or the diameter) of the circle made by the outer wheels of the vehicle while making a complete turn.
How do you find the turning angle?
s = wheel base a = steering wheel angle n = steering ratio (e.g. for 16:1, n = 16) r = radius of curvature, in the same units as the wheel base So: r = s / (sqrt(2 – 2 * cos(2*a/n)) For an angle of zero degrees, the radius of curvature is infinite, which is expected.
How do you adjust an Ackerman angle?
You can usually adjust the Ackerman by moving the left front tie rod end in a slotted spindle arm. Moving the tie rod end closer to the ball joint will create more Ackerman. Some cars use an offset slug design to make the adjustment.
What percentage is Ackerman?
Now to answer the question of what is the ‘percentage’ Ackerman: the % is Usually defined as. (Steer angle of inside tire relative to outside tire)/(Ackerman suggested steer angle of inside tire relative to outside tire)*100%
What is Ackerman angle drift?
What is Ackermann? In simple terms, Ackermann geometry or steering geometry defines inner and outer wheel (leading and trailing in drifting) steering angle difference. Ackermann is needed to run all the wheels around the turn center to reduce scrub, as demonstrated in the picture below.
